This image was created by median combining 7 x 90 second unfiltered images taken with a Takahashi Epsilon 250 with SBIG ST-8XE CCD. The image has been cut down to be 15 x 15 arc minutes in size.

M53 (NGC 5024) is about 60,000 light years from the Galactic center and about the same distance from the Solar system. It has a diameter of about 220 light years.
